In order to guarantee the steady operation of overhead contact line,design a monitor system which can monitor temperature of wire junction and phase change point. Monitor system detects temperature of high-voltage compartment via temperature sensor,and transfers data from overhead contact line to data monitoring center software timely via two-stage wireless transmission network. The first stage uses a short-range wireless transmission type of free band,and the other uses the GPRS network not restricted by region. Customers can remotely manage monitoring information easily, and retrieve, query, and monitor alarm of wire junction and phase change point of overhead contact line.
